case 语句
简单case表达式
case 变量
     when 值1 then 执行块;
     when 值2 then 执行块;
     when 值3 then 执行块;
     …..;
     [else 执行块 ;]
end case;

when 值1 then 执行块;当值1=变量时候,执行then后面的语句
else:所有值都不匹配的情况,所要执行的操作

这里写图片描述

搜索case表达式
case
     when 表达式1 then 执行块1;
     when 表达式2 then 执行块2;
     ..
     [else 执行块n ;]
end case;

表达式1:是条件语句,返回true和false

这里写图片描述

posted on 2017-05-22 20:20  2637282556  阅读(97)  评论(0编辑  收藏  举报